Game freezes in one specific instance...

the game has always run very well on my computer, and i can fly for hours without any crashes or other problems (other than the occasional micro-freeze during battle).

 

however, i was playing the Georgian Oil War campaign, the first phase (it is the second option on my campaigns list under 'deployment'). i was trying to start the third mission, and right after i hit the pause key to start the mission, it runs for about 2 seconds then freezes. i can still hear sound and everything, but nothing responds and i have to force windows to kill the game.

 

i tried any number of other missions and flights with no freezing problems of any sort. it is just that mission in the campaign. any ideas? i would like to continue if possible...just strange it is so isolated.

I think what you might be experiencing is an issue with the cone formation for ground troops, though I'm not entirely sure which missions that this affected. (I've never had it on my own machines, sadly.)

 

You could open the mission file for that mission in the Mission Editor and change formations on ground units and see if that changes anything. I'll try to replicate it on my own and if I succeed I'll see if I can give you a replacement miz file.
